My name is Svetla. I grew up in a picturesque landscape in southwestern Bulgaria, along the migratory bird route “Via Aristoteles”. Even as a child, I observed the birds migrating north in spring and south in autumn, always wondering who they were, where they came from, and where their journey led. This childhood curiosity still accompanies me today.

Many years later, I bought my first binoculars and delved deeper into the world of birds. Migratory birds particularly captivated me with their endurance, their perfectly organized lives along the route, and their ability to travel thousands of kilometers, returning reliably to their breeding grounds.

This fascination led me to photography—initially simply to help identify difficult-to-recognize species. However, it quickly evolved into a passionate hobby. Bird photography immediately captivated me, shifting my focus from pure documentation to experiential photography.

Light conditions, seasonal changes, and bird behavior continually inspire me. Over time, my photographic world expanded—from bird photography to a broader enthusiasm for flora and fauna. Still, migratory birds remain my heartfelt topic, as their journeys tell compelling stories of endurance, transformation, and nature’s delicate balance.

For me, photography means immersing myself in nature. My photos capture authentic moments experienced during walks, through listening, spontaneous encounters, or quiet observation.

Through my photography, I aim to share my passion for nature. It takes very little to consciously experience nature—presence, mindfulness, and a deep appreciation of the moment are far more valuable than technical equipment. Tools like bird identification apps or cameras can enrich the experience, but they aren’t essential.

My photographs aim to inspire people to consciously experience nature and rediscover its wonders. I firmly believe that once we genuinely perceive and understand the animal world, we learn to love and protect it.

Migratory birds play a crucial role in ecosystems. However, their journeys are becoming increasingly perilous due to climate change, shrinking breeding grounds, and environmental destruction. It is our responsibility to preserve their habitats and maintain nature’s delicate balance—for the birds, for nature, and ultimately, for ourselves.
